Walmart will host a grand reopening of its newly remodeled Goose Creek store, showcasing upgrades that reflect the company's Store of the Future model.
The transformation includes a modernized layout, faster and more convenient shopping options, enhanced digital tools, and an expanded assortment of on-trend products, all designed to help customers shop how and when they want.
Customers will notice:
- Expanded aisles and interactive displays that help them visualize merchandise in their homes.
- An expanded selection of healthy foods and affordable premium brands, including De'Longhi, Oura, Jessica Simpson and Lemme.
- More speed and convenience options, including delivery in as little as one hour.
- An enhanced Walmart app experience that allows customers to navigate store aisles, access store services and schedule oil changes at the Auto Care Center.
- A Vision Center designed for greater privacy and convenience, featuring brands such as Nike, Calvin Klein and DKNY, along with services including free cleanings and adjustments.
The grand reopening highlights Walmart's commitment to delivering a modern, efficient and intuitive shopping experience, whether customers shop in-store or online.
The Goose Creek location is one of 29 Walmart stores in South Carolina scheduled for remodeling in 2026 and one of approximately 650 remodeled stores nationwide.
Community Giving
The event will also highlight Walmart's continued investment in the community with the presentation of $5,500 in grants to local organizations, including:
- Mad Park Community — $1,500
- Jean's Angels — $1,500
- Sunflowers of HOPE — $1,500
- KIASWI — $1,000
